* BlowYouAway: When Leafa is called, she summons a gust of wind magic that throws the opponent into the air, which opens them up for air combos.

* CombatMedic: While Holo is fully capable of offense support, her Up Support functions as this. When used, Holo generates a circle near her that restores the player's HP and Climax Gauge while the player stands in it. However, it will become less effective with successive uses.



* CounterAttack:
** Kuroneko's Up Support creates a magic glyph around the player who called her; if the player is attacked while this is active, any knockback the player would've taken is negated and the player is instead shot straight into the air. If the opponent happens to be standing next to the glyph when it triggers, it ''also'' launches the opponent straight up and deals an equivalent amount of damage. The glyph also negates attacks if the player is hit in the middle of a Climax. The player has to watch Kuroneko though, since if she is attacked, the glyph disperses.
** Hinata's Neutral Support causes her to appear in front of her summoner. If attacked by the opponent, the attack is negated and the opponent auto-blocks, whether he/she wants to or not.
* DeathFromAbove: Celty's Up Support makes her fall from the sky on her bike to land on the ground in front of the player. If the opponent happens to be there, they'll get smushed too.



* ImprobableWeaponUser: Koko Kaga's Up Support summons her with a bouquet of roses. She will then proceed to walk up to the opponent, and if she reaches him/her, she'll slap the opponent silly using her bouquet for a combo before shooting a kiss that drains the opponent's Climax Meter.



* LimitBreak: Climaxes.
** If Sadao Mao is your Support, he can also use one. Both of his Support Attacks are standard rushing punches that deal weak damage. However, if two punches connect in a row, the third will summon him in [[SuperMode Demon Mode]], where he will pull off an incredibly powerful and lengthy attack.



* NoSell: Touma's Imagine Breaker. It will stop any attack in its tracks, including ''Climaxes'', and stops opponents from approaching directly by dealing minor damage and blasting them on contact. The player summoning him just has to make sure he doesn't [[AchillesHeel get hit anywhere else.]]

** Erio's Neutral Support has her run up to the opponent and wrap herself in a blanket, then hop around. This neutralizes all attacks the opponent throws, and unlike Touma, she can get hit anywhere without getting desummoned. However, this only works in proximity, so it's no good if the opponent simply runs past her.
* OverlyLongFightingAnimation: Boogiepop's Up Support makes her appear, then the screen turns black while a song plays. This lasts for a good five seconds before she turns around, after which slashes flash across the screen and smack the opponent, which is an [[UnblockableAttack unblockable]] AlwaysAccurateAttack. Interestingly, unlike many assists of this type that appear in other fighting games, Boogiepop is completely invincible during the animation, which essentially means it grants her summoner a free hit.
* PinballProjectile: Kino's Up Support makes her appear and shoot a bullet high. If the initial shot misses, it'll bounce off the walls and come back for a surprise attack.

* PowerUpFood: When Ryuuji is called for his Neutral Support, he tosses out a bento bag, a bento box, or bento boxes. The first adds a little regenerative HP to the player's HP meter, the second adds to the Climax Gauge, and the third does both. However, taking a bento bag after some bento boxes actually ''reduces'' the player's Climax Gauge by one stage. Also, if your opponent is savvy, they can steal the food for themselves.


Added DiffLines:

* TurnsRed: When called to use his Up Support, Ryuuji sweeps the floor sparkling clean, then comes back around and hits the opponent multiple times from behind. However, if he is hit prematurely with a projectile or an EX Attack, he gains a red BattleAura and speeds up. This also allows him to hit his target on the first pass instead of the second, and he hits more times.

[[quoteright:380:http://static.tvtropes.org/pmwiki/pub/images/587579dc61f9335a2f44f29f4859d64a.jpg]]''Dengeki Bunko Fighting Climax'' is a {{Fighting Game}} {{crossover}} between various light novel series published under the Dengeki Bunko imprint ([[MyFriendsAndZoidberg and]] [[VideoGame/ValkyriaChronicles Valkyria Chronicles]] and [[VideoGame/VirtuaFighter Virtua Fighter]]) to [[MilestoneCelebration celebrate the 20th anniversary]] of the imprint. Developed by French Bread (of {{Melty Blood}} fame) and published by {{SEGA}}, it was first released in Japanese arcades in March 18, 2014, with a {{PS3}} and {{PS Vita}} release followed on November 13, 2014.

The gameplay consists of players choosing two characters from a playable and support roster, with the latter being used for various assist attacks. One can also utilize various Impact Skill attacks unique to each character as well as Blast Attacks to escape combos.

Modes found in the console release include a story mode; a Dream Duel campaign; as well as online multiplayer.

Despite many crossovers of this nature [[NoExportForYou never being released outside Japan]], [[AvertedTrope it's set to be released by SEGA sometime in 2015 in North America and Europe]].
